Description

Collisions involving HM Ships INFLEXIBLE and FEARLESS, HM Submarines K14, K22, K17, K4 and K6. Cdr. E W Leir D S O, R N HMS ITHURIEL commanding 13th submarine Flotilla: loss of HM Submarine K17
